GEARWRENCH Pry Bars
From aligning & rolling head pry bars to our innovative indexing and extendable indexing pry bars, GEARWRENCH offers a wide variety of pry bars for almost every application. They are ideal for engine re-positioning and placement, aligning steel components, and re-positioning equipment. Available in sets and individually, these pry bars can handle just about any prying or aligning application.
- Black phosphate coating to resit rust and corrosion
- Indexing pry bars provide superior leverage in the most hard to reach locations

GEARWRENCH Angled Tip Pry Bars
The acetate handle pry bars have a fixed angled tip for access and leverage and a special formulation handle that gives greater resistance to cold temperatures and to drops. The shaft is coated in black phosphate which reduces corrosion and rust. Ideal for medium-duty automotive and industrial applications.

Gear wrench 3-Piece pry bar set consisting of: 82208 8-Inch Indexing pry bar - smooth profile, 82210 10-Inch indexing pry bar - smooth profile, and 82216 16-Inch indexing pry bar - smooth profile. Gear wrench pry bars are indexable to 180 degrees for greater leverage with 14 locking positions for unmatch access. Long handle allows you to put the bar where you need it for best leverage. Industrial steel construction exceeds ANSI requirements for providen strength.
